Structural Steel Definitions. Structural steel is used in buildings for reinforcing structures, columns, roofing, beams, structural strengthening, and exterior. A regulated category of steel, structural steel has to meet industry standards for dimensional tolerances and composition. In the united states, steel grades are specified and regulated by astm international. Fundamentally, it is defined as steel optimized for use in building construction—differentiated from a steel grade one might use to engineer tools, or stainless steel popularly used in kitchen surfaces and appliances.
